Usual Indicators of A/c Problems



Just how can house owners recognize problems with their air conditioning systems prior to they intensify? Recognizing usual indications of AC issues is vital for prompt upkeep. One prevalent indication wants air conditioning; if the air conditioning system falls short to reduce the interior temperature, it may signify underlying issues. Uncommon noises, such as grinding or hissing, can additionally show mechanical failings or loosened components - ac unit replacement. Furthermore, house owners ought to be wary of weird odors emanating from the unit, which may suggest mold growth or electric troubles. Regular biking on and off, called brief cycling, can show thermostat concerns or refrigerant leakages. A rise in power bills without a matching increase in use may aim to ineffectiveness. By staying sharp to these indication, homeowners can stop much more substantial concerns and pricey repair services, ensuring their air conditioning systems run efficiently throughout the warmer months

Comprehending Cooling Agent Issues



Refrigerant problems can significantly influence the effectiveness of a HVAC system. Homeowners need to be mindful of the indications of low refrigerant levels and the relevance of finding refrigerant leakages. Addressing these issues immediately can protect against further damages to the system and guarantee optimal cooling performance.


Low Refrigerant Degrees



A typical concern that homeowners might encounter with their a/c systems is low cooling agent levels, which can substantially affect the system's efficiency and performance. Cooling agent is crucial for the cooling process, soaking up warm from interior air and releasing it outside. When degrees drop, the air conditioning system struggles to cool down the area successfully, leading to increased energy usage and potential system pressure. Signs and symptoms of low refrigerant include insufficient air conditioning, longer run times, and ice formation on the evaporator coils. Home owners may additionally discover uncommon noises as the compressor functions harder to make up for the shortage. It is very important for property owners to recognize the significance of preserving appropriate cooling agent degrees to ensure peak HVAC performance and longevity.


Refrigerant Leaks Detection



Where might a property owner begin when faced with the opportunity of cooling agent leaks in their a/c system? The initial step includes monitoring the system's performance. Indications such as decreased cooling down performance, ice formation on coils, or hissing audios might suggest a refrigerant leakage. Property owners must additionally look for noticeable indicators of oil residue, frequently an indicator of a leakage. Using a cooling agent leakage detector can supply more accurate recognition. If uncertainties continue, speaking with a certified HVAC professional is essential, as they have the proficiency and devices to locate leakages successfully. Motivate detection and repair work of cooling agent leakages not just enhance system performance yet likewise avoid possible environmental injury, making it an important facet of a/c maintenance.

Clogged Filters and Their Consequences



While numerous house owners may neglect the significance of routine filter maintenance, clogged filters can bring about considerable consequences for a/c systems. When filters become obstructed with dirt, dirt, and debris, air movement is limited. This decrease in air flow requires the system to work harder, bring about raised power usage and possibly higher energy costs. In time, this pressure can cause deterioration on elements, causing premature system failing.


In addition, blocked filters can endanger indoor air high quality. Contaminants and irritants may circulate throughout the home, exacerbating respiratory system issues and allergic reactions for owners. Poor air movement can create the evaporator coil to ice up, leading to expensive repair work and ineffective cooling efficiency. Frequently changing or cleansing filters is a basic yet vital maintenance job that can help assure the durability and efficiency of HVAC systems, inevitably profiting both the house owner's comfort and their funds.

Thermostat Malfunctions Discussed



What takes place when a thermostat breakdowns can greatly impact both convenience and energy effectiveness in a home (HVAC contractor). A defective thermostat may fail to properly read the temperature, leading to overcooling or insufficient cooling. This inconsistency can trigger discomfort for occupants and lead to greater energy bills, as the a/c system functions more difficult than needed


Usual problems include dead batteries, which can render digital thermostats defective, and loose circuitry that disrupts communication between the thermostat and the cooling and heating unit. Furthermore, outdated or poorly adjusted thermostats may not react correctly to temperature changes, better aggravating energy inefficiency.


Property owners ought to be alert for signs of malfunction, such as inconsistent temperatures or unanticipated power expenses. Routine checks and understanding of the thermostat's capability can help determine troubles early, making sure peak efficiency of the a/c system. Dealing with thermostat issues without delay is necessary for maintaining a comfy living atmosphere and handling energy intake efficiently.
